Linux虛擬機三種網絡配置


 

Host-Only

Host-only    僅主機模式

1,虛擬機網絡設置

配置虛擬機的網絡設置為hostonly

2,虛擬軟件網絡設置

選擇vmware - 編輯 – 虛擬機網絡編輯器

3,配置虛擬軟件中vmnet1的IP

為VMnet1選擇一個網段,不修改0號ip地址。

4,查看win7 VMnet1網絡

此時,win7機器上的vmware vmnet1網絡已經改變

這個IP地址其實是Windows的IP地址,該IP地址是用於與host-only網絡連接方式的虛擬機進行通信的

 

5,修改虛擬機的ip地址信息

vi /etc/sysconfig/network-scripts/ifcfg-eth0

DEVICE="eth0"

BOOTPROTO="static"

ONBOOT="yes"

TYPE="Ethernet"

IPADDR=192.168.80.3

NETMASK=255.255.255.0

可選項:

GATEWAY=192.168.80.1

DNS1=8.8.8.8

 

主要修改BOOTPROTO  IPADDR  NETMASK 這三項

6,重啟網絡服務

修改完后保存退出,重啟網絡服務

# service network restart

使用ifconfig命令查看

7,測試連接

測試:在windows上ping Linux (ping   192.168.80.3)

8,遠程連接工具連接該虛擬機:

圖解

NAT

NAT    網絡地址轉換Network Address Translation

 

1,虛擬機網絡設置

配置虛擬機的網絡設置為NAT

2,虛擬軟件網絡設置

選擇vmware - 編輯 – 虛擬機網絡編輯器

3,配置虛擬軟件中vmnet8的IP

為VMne8選擇一個網段,不修改0號ip地址。默認設置2號ip地址為網關。

4,查看win7 VMnet8網絡

此時,win7機器上的vmware vmnet8網絡已經改變

5,修改虛擬機的ip地址信息

vi /etc/sysconfig/network-scripts/ifcfg-eth0

DEVICE="eth0"

BOOTPROTO="static"

ONBOOT="yes"

TYPE="Ethernet"

IPADDR=192.168.2.3

NETMASK=255.255.255.0

GATEWAY=192.168.2.2    # 第一個2是網段,步驟 3中設置的,第二個2是ip,固定

DNS1=8.8.8.8

6,重啟網絡服務

修改完后保存退出,重啟網絡服務

# service network restart

使用ifconfig命令查看

7,測試連接

測試:在windows上ping Linux (ping  192.168.2.3)

8,遠程連接工具連接該虛擬機:

圖解

橋接

Bridged(橋接)     虛擬機guest和宿主機host要在同一網段,只要host可以上網,guest就可以上網

 

1 虛擬機網絡設置

配置虛擬機的網絡設置為bridge

前提,通過ipconfig 查看物理機的網段,還要確保要修改的ip地址沒有被占用(ping ip)

2 修改虛擬機的ip地址信息

vi /etc/sysconfig/network-scripts/ifcfg-eth0

DEVICE="eth0"

BOOTPROTO="static"

ONBOOT="yes"

TYPE="Ethernet"

IPADDR=192.168.1.120

NETMASK=255.255.255.0

可選項:

GATEWAY=192.168.1.1

DNS1=8.8.8.8

 

3 重啟網絡服務

修改完后保存退出,重啟網絡服務

# service network restart

使用ifconfig命令查看

4 測試連接

測試:在windows上ping Linux (ping   192.168.1.120)

測試:ping www.baidu.com

5遠程連接工具連接該虛擬機:

圖解

防火牆

#查看防火牆狀態

service iptables status

#開啟防火牆

service iptables start

#關閉防火牆

service iptables stop

#重啟防火牆

service  iptables  restart

 

或者

開啟:/etc/init.d/iptables start 

關閉:/etc/init.d/iptables stop 

重啟:/etc/init.d/iptables restart 

 

#查看防火牆開機啟動狀態

chkconfig iptables –list

#開機啟動

chkconfig  iptables  on

#關閉防火牆開機啟動

chkconfig iptables off

/sbin/chkconfig --level 2345 iptables off        關閉防火牆的自動運行

 

配置集群環境時,需要關閉各節點的防火牆。


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M